SECTORAL POLICIES / Fisheries
NGO Bloom denounces “undemocratic” use of EU objection on tuna fishing
Brussels, 05/04/2023 (Agence Europe)

The NGO Bloom on Wednesday 5 April called the European Commission’s proposal to object to measures (contained in a resolution) of the Indian Ocean Tuna Commission (IOTC) restricting the use of fish aggregating devices (FADs) “undemocratic”.
